What role does the placenta play in managing fetal waste products?

  • A. Filters toxins
  • B. Facilitates nutrient absorption
  • C. Removes carbon dioxide
  • D. All of the above
Correct Answer: D

Rationale: The correct answer is D because the placenta performs multiple functions in managing fetal waste products. It filters toxins, facilitates nutrient absorption, and removes carbon dioxide. The placenta acts as a barrier between the mother and the fetus, allowing for the exchange of nutrients and waste products. Therefore, all of the above choices are correct in describing the role of the placenta in managing fetal waste products.
